Write an explicit formula for each sequence and find the 7th term for each

1. -4, 12, -36
2. 12, 3, 3/4

Answer:

  1. a[n] = -4·(-3)^(n-1); -2916
  2. a[n] = 12·(1/4)^(n -1); 3/1024

Explanation:

You want the explicit formula for each of the geometric sequences, and the 7th term.

  1. -4, 12, -36
  2. 12, 3, 3/4

Explicit formula

The explicit formula for a geometric sequence with first term a[1] and common ratio r is ...

a[n] = a[1]·r^(n-1)

1. a[1] = -4, r = -3

The explicit formula is ...

a[n] = -4·(-3)^(n-1)

The 7th term is ...

a[7] = -4·(-3)^(7-1) = -2916

2. a[1] = 12, r = 1/4

The explicit formula is ...

a[n] = 12·(1/4)^(n -1)

The 7th term is ...

a[7] = 12·(1/4)^(7-1) = 3/1024
